Used in strategy entry or exit statements to specify a Market price for an entry or an exit.

A Market Buy order will execute at the current ask price and a Market Sell order will execute at the current bid price.

Usage

At Market

Where:

At - is a skip word and can be omitted.

Example

Buy a user-set number of shares at Market price on open of next bar:

Buy Next Bar At Market;
